ESQ-1 Digital / Analog Synthesizer (Episode 2 Preview)
YouTube via williamenroh.
"This is a preview for Inside Synthesis Episode 2. It will demonstrate LFO programming on synthesizers that lack real-time phrase/drumbeat triggering, such as the ESQ-1.
While the ESQ-1 has a built-in sequencer, there's no way to dynamically control the sequences. To make matters more challenging, the ESQ-1 lacks a modulation sequencer of the MS-2000 (as seen in Episode 1).
But that doesn't mean you can't do real-time drumbeats and arpeggiations.
